    Abstract

    In this work a multi purpose setup has been developed for homo- and copolymerizations of ethylene and 1-hexene in slurry and gas phase. Polymerization experiments have been executed in semi-batch mode with a heterogeneous metallocene catalyst under industrial conditions. During the gas-phase polymerizations the monomer concentrations have been measured and controlled online. The activities for both monomers were measured with flow meter techniques.
